Misa Hylton’s Fashion Academy Receives Grant from Gucci

Hylton’s triumphs reach new heights as her academy gets backed by Gucci.

Misa Hylton’s success has dominated the fashion industry for years, and she’s on no course to stop there. The legendary stylist has now announced that the Misa Hylton Fashion Academy (MHFA) has been awarded a special grant from Gucci

From Mary J. Blige to Puffy, Hylton has created numerous innovative looks that helped make fashion what it is today. Remember the iconic ‘90s music video “Crush on You”, where Lil’ Kim made a statement in vibrant furs? I mean, how could we ever forget. 

Seamlessly pairing hip-hop and high fashion, Hylton’s aesthetics were ahead of her time, and many have come back in style today such as the signature thick lip liner and glossy leather jackets. No one can really mix culture and creativity quite like her. 

One of her current projects is supervising the MHFA, a school based in New York that aims to help the next generation of creatives striving for a career in fashion. Established in 2012, it consists mostly of black pupils who want to become revolutionary designers and stylists. 

The MHFA has recently gained more recognition through the support of Gucci, who offer a Changemakers Impact Fund, awarding up to $50,000 to non-profit organizations. The academy was selected alongside 15 others and will help provide greater opportunities for black children.
